Two Methods Of Making Table Of Content On Blogger
1.Automatic Method
2.Manual Method
Automatic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ger.
As by the name automatic, here you need to choose h2 or h3 or h4 as your
content and by default, it is set at H2. That means whatever you put on H2 the heading is automatically set as a table of content.
By default, the design isn't attractive but I modified by my own choice. You can make yourself as your own.
Advantage of Automatic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
- It is automatic that all H2 Heading goes automatic to Table of content.
- Automatic table of content for blogger saves a lot of time than manual method.
Disadvantages of Automatic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
- Automatic table of content use javascript that will affect your page loading speed.
- Cannot include subtopic like H3.
- It cannot use on the AMP template.
Manual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
On the manual method, you can create a table of content manually means you can include anything in your table of content as well as you can include subtopic also.
Advantages Of Manual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
- No need of javascript means you save more than 1.2s to load your page fully.
- You can use on AMP Template also.
- It can include subtopics also on your table of content.
Disadvantage Of Manual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
- Lots of time needed as the process is manual.
- It needs some HTML skills.
I recommend the automatic method if you don't have time but if you have then using the manual method will be best.

Step-Wise Process for Manual Method To Make Table Of Content On Blogger
As the manual method is a little bit time consuming as well as you need to familiar with some HTML.
Let's start the step-wise method of adding a table of contents in the blogger.
Step1: Go to your blogger dashboard then point your mouse towards the theme option.
![]() |
Blogger Dashboard >Theme |
Step2: Now click on edit HTML.
![]() |
Edit HTML |
Step 3: Now, on the HTML section of the blogger again search on the theme using "CTRL+F" for " ]]></b:skin> " and again copy the code below and paste code above " ]]></b:skin> ".
Code:
/*Created by https://www.pkbaniya.com.np/ [Saroj-Tech ] */ .toc {border: 3px solid #A2A9B1;background-color: #F8F9FA;display: block;line-height: 1.4em;width: 70%;display: block;padding: 20px 30px 10px;}.toc ul li {list-style-type: none;}.toc a {text-decoration: none;}.toc strong {font-size: 20px;}.toc a:hover {text-decoration: underline;}{codeBox}
![]() |
Step 2 |
Step4: Now return to the post section and click on HTML to goto HTML section then paste the code below to make it work well.
Code:
<div class="toc"> <strong>Contents [ hide ] </strong> <ul> <li> <span>1.</span><a href="#point1">Heading </a></li> <ul> <li><span>1.1.</span><a href="#sub1">Sub-Heading 1</a></li> <li><span>1.2.</span><a href="#sub2">Sub-Heading 2</a></li> <li><span>1.3.</span><a href="#sub3">Sub-Heading 3</a></li> </ul> <li><span>2.</span><a href="#point2">Heading 2 </a></li> <li><span>3.</span><a href="#point3">Heading 3 </a></li> <li><span>4.</span><a href="#point4">Heading 2 </a></li> <li><span>5.</span><a href="#point5">Heading 3 </a></li> </ul> </div>{codeBox}
![]() |
Place Where You Want Table Of Contents |
Step5: Now give id to your headings that you want to include in your table of contents on blogger post.
Example: [ id="post1" ] for my first heading.
![]() |
Give Id |
Step6: Give id to your sub-headings if there are any Sub-Headings in your post.
Example: [ id="sub1" ] for first sub-heading.
![]() |
Give Id to Sub-Headings |
Step7: Now, Change your "Headings" and "Sub-Headings" according to your id and headings.
